What are three things Wisconsin needs to do in order to beat Purdue on Tuesday?

MID-RANGE: CAN WISCONSIN LIMIT PURDUE FROM THREE?

In the first meeting between the two teams about a third of the Boilermakers, field goal attempts came from three as they attempted 19 three’s on 60 field goal attempts.

Purdue made nine of their 3-point attempts against Wisconsin as six different Boilermakers made a three. They were led by Sasha Stefanovic who went 3-for-8 in Purdue’s win over Wisconsin.

Purdue over conference play is averaging 6.9 made three’s a game and since making a season high 19 three’s on 34 attempts in their win over Iowa in the three games since then the Boilers have shot a combined 16-for-53 from three.

Stefanovic leads the team in 3-point attempts over conference play as 84 of his 121 field goal opportunities have come from 3-point range. Although Wisconsin will need to be aware of where Stefanovic is on the floor to make sure he can’t attempt an uncontested three the Badgers defense will also need to know where Eric Hunter is too.

Hunter is second to Stefanovic in 3-point attempts over conference play with 60 but he’s making 38.3 percent of his opportunities from three.

Between the two Wisconsin can’t afford to lose either in transition as they will take advantage of their open three’s and make Wisconsin pay for their mistake.
